How flexible is WoW's class/race system? Is it like AD&D where race defines your class or is like like D&D3e where any race can be any class. I don't expect one of those skeleton dudes or orcs to be a paladin, but is it flexible enough to allow, say an elf to be a paladin?

No, it's like EQ1 where you are limited to the classes they want the races to be so you cannot be a Night Elf Paladin.
